Placement of Bridge Beams to Close Northbound Interstate 476 on July 20

Northeastern Extension to be closed for six hours between Lansdale and Quakertown.
The Pennsylvania Turnpike Commission cautions motorists that a 13-mile stretch of the Northeastern Extension (I-476) will be closed northbound for six hours July 20 between the Lansdale (Exit #31) and Quakertown (Exit #44) interchanges. The closure is necessary for the protection of motorists and workers during placement of concrete beams on the structure that carries Ridge Road (State Route 563) over the Turnpike at milepost A37.4 in Salford Township, Montgomery County.
 
At 12:01 a.m., July 20, northbound traffic will be diverted off at the Lansdale Interchange. By 6 a.m. the detour will be lifted and the Northeastern Extension reopened to traffic.
 
Southbound I-476 will remain open to motorists traveling south to the east/west Turnpike mainline or to the Mid-County Interchange continuing southbound on the Blue Route (I-476) to I-76/I-95.

Prior to the closure, motorists should be prepared for the northbound right lane to be closed July 19 at 8 p.m. and the southbound left lane to be closed at 10 p.m. between milepost A35-A39. The speed limit will be posted at 40 mph until the single-lane patterns are lifted. Construction-zone speed limits are enforceable and fines will be doubled.
 
Pennsylvania State Police and Turnpike personnel will be positioned at the Lansdale Interchange to assist motorists. DETOURS
 
• Traveling northbound on I-476 — Exit at Lansdale Interchange (Exit #31):  take State Route 63 east (Sumneytown Pike) to Route 309 north to State Route 663 south (John Fries Hwy.) to reenter the Turnpike at the Quakertown Interchange (Exit #44) to continue northbound on I-476.
